    About the role#

    The SkillBridge Project Scheduling Coordinator Intern will gain hands-on experience coordinating personnel and resources across Asset Management and Transactional Due Diligence projects. This role provides Service Members with exposure to scheduling field teams, balancing complex project needs, and supporting due diligence and assessment workflows. Interns will learn how to optimize field resource deployment, manage availability, and maintain project efficiency across multiple programs.

    What you'll do#

    • Coordinate and manage internal and external field resources, including building assessors, engineers, architects, and due diligence specialists, using project management software.
    • Track and maintain resource availability, qualifications, skillsets, and geographic locations to support project requirements.
    • Assist with planning and scheduling building assessments, inspections, and transactional due diligence engagements.
    • Serve as a liaison between operational leadership, project resources, and client representatives to ensure alignment on project timelines and staffing needs.
    • Support cross-divisional initiatives to identify qualified, cost-effective personnel for upcoming projects and programs.
    • Ensure compliance with client requirements, including background checks, military base access, site access, and security protocols.
    • Analyze field capacity and forecast resource needs to optimize project execution and team productivity.

    About Bureau Veritas Group

    Founded in 1828 and headquartered in Courbevoie, Paris, Bureau Veritas Group is a privately held organization with over 10,000 employees. The firm provides testing, inspection, and certification services across sectors including marine, offshore, oil and gas, construction, and consumer products. It operates as a business-to-business entity that assists public authorities and companies in managing assets and addressing environmental and safety standards.
